AGRTP International Full-Time Scholarship at Charles Sturt University 2025.

Australian Government Research Training Program International Scholarships are awarded to postgraduate researchers from overseas with exceptional promise on the basis of academic merit and research potential. Benefits

Stipend Full-Time: $35,000 annually (2024 rate), payable in fortnightly instalments to a nominated Australian bank account.

Tuition Fees: Scholarship candidates are exempt from fees for a period equivalent to three years (six sessions) for PhD/Research Doctorate OR two years (four sessions) for Research Masters at full-time study.

Operating Funds: Scholarship candidates are allocated an allowance to assist with the reimbursement of costs associated with a candidate’s research.

Relocation Allowance: Scholarship candidates may be eligible to receive a relocation allowance for the cost of relocating themselves, their spouse, and dependants to a Charles Sturt campus to a maximum of AUD $5,000.

Health insurance: All International students studying in Australia are required to purchase and maintain Overseas Student Health Cover (OSHC). An AGRTP International Scholarship covers the cost of a standard OSHC policy for the candidate for three years full-time equivalent. This scholarship does not cover the cost of OSHC for dependents.

Requirements

AGRTP International Scholarships are generally for full-time study towards higher degrees by research. These scholarships are highly competitive, and only applicants who meet the following eligibility criteria will be considered:

  • Commencing a Charles Sturt University HDR program or currently enrolled
  • Enrolling/enrolled as a full-time candidate who will be studying on a Charles Sturt University campus

AGRTP International Scholarships will not be available to those who:

  • Are enrolled concurrently in any other program unless it is essential to the success of the HDR or exceptional circumstances exist and are approved.
  • Are receiving another Commonwealth-funded postgraduate research scholarship

Charles Sturt will rank scholarship applicants according to specified criteria. See the Scholarship Application Guide for further details.

NB. Scholarships will be reduced by any periods of HDR study undertaken towards the degree prior to the commencement of the scholarship.

Prospective candidates:

Prospective Higher Degree by Research candidates can apply for an AGRTP International Scholarship when completing their Charles Sturt course admission application.

Current International Charles Sturt HDR candidates

International candidates currently enrolled in a Charles Sturt HDR course must complete a separate scholarship application.
